Default Imporving Aero Index Score?

My Aero rating is 3.4. The rest of my ratings are 4. Is this Areo rating
decreasing my overall performance? If so how can I increase the rating?

Default Imporving Aero Index Score?

I believe that as long as your graphics scores are above 3.0, then Aero
offers all that is available to you.

Aero in general is an additional layer of eye candy, so it will ding system
performance on it's own. The rating simply decides that Aero can run without
causing a noticable difference in performance.
